UMBC Defeats Men's Lacrosse

Courtesy: UAlbany Sports Information

Baltimore, Md. – Ryan Smith scored a career-high five goals and added three assists to lead UMBC to a 14-10 victory over UAlbany in a showdown for first place in the America East Conference standings on Saturday, April 12 at UMBC Stadium. The Retrievers, who are ranked No. 9 in the USILA national poll and 11th by Inside Lacrosse, extended their winning streak to seven straight.

UAlbany (5-6, AE 2-1) rallied from a three-goal halftime deficit to draw even at eight apiece midway through the third quarter. Nate Sullivan found the net in a man-advantage situation 49 seconds into the period. The Great Danes won the following face-off, and Brian Caufield converted Steve Ammann’s feed. Tyler Endres, a defensive midfielder, then tallied his first goal of the season.

UMBC (8-3, AE 3-0) regrouped with four unanswered goals, including a pair in the final minute of the quarter. Terry Kimener, an All-America midfielder, forced a turnover and then scored himself to put his team on top for good with 7:35 remaining. Smith, a junior college transfer, converted back-to-back goals, including his fifth of the game with 39 seconds to play. Taylor Marino won the subsequent face-off to set up Maxx Davis’s goal with just one tick left on the clock.

The Retrievers, who have won 10 in a row at home, the second longest streak among Division I teams, led 5-4 in the second quarter, but then exploded with three goals in a 55-second span. UMBC won two consecutive face-offs to score 13 seconds apart, as Matt Latham and Smith connected. Freshman attack Dom Scalzo followed with his fifth of the season in a man-up situation after UAlbany’s Mike Ammann went to the penalty box for pushing.

Freshman Brian Caufield had three goals and two assists for the Great Danes, who had their five-game win streak halted. Corye Small and Sullivan each scored twice. UMBC’s Kimener finished with two goals and two assists. The start of the fourth quarter was delayed for 35 minutes due to lightning.
